Output a28b515bbe4d4cf1ae246f2a9b1a66ca009fcd65f3014c0ae8ca3bf150ddb97d:7

value
765432216
script pubkey
OP_0 OP_PUSHBYTES_20 8a48f9bb84f0ecc0f486ac1520536fc71562e678
address
bc1q3fy0nwuy7rkvpayx4s2jq5m0cu2k9encrzex34
transaction
a28b515bbe4d4cf1ae246f2a9b1a66ca009fcd65f3014c0ae8ca3bf150ddb97d
confirmations
23608
spent
true